SQL Server is a data engine introduced by Microsoft. It provides an environment used to create and manage databases.

It allows secure and efficient storage.

It provides other components and services that support the business intelligence platform to generate reports and help analyze the data.

Similar to other RDBMS software, SQL Server is built on top of SQL, a standard programming language for interacting with the relational databases.

SQL server is tied to Transact-SQL, or T-SQL, the Microsoft’s implementation of SQL that adds a set of proprietary programming constructs.


Understand the basic concepts of relational databases ensure refined code by developers.

Create reports of sorted and restricted data.

Run data manipulation statements (DML).

Control database access to specific objects.

Manage schema objects.

Manage objects with data dictionary views.

Retrieve row and column data from tables.

Control privileges at the object and system level.

Create indexes and constraints alter existing schema objects.

Create and query external tables.

SQL Server works exclusively on Windows environment for more than 20 years.

In 2016, Microsoft made it available on Linux. SQL Server 2017 became generally available in October 2016 that ran on both Windows and Linux.

